Kamilya Jubran is a Palestinian singer, songwriter, and musician.

Kamilya Jubran was born in Acre (Akka) in 1962 to Palestinian parents. Her father Elias is a music teacher and maker of traditional Palestinian instruments such as the oud. Her brother Khaled is also a musician. Jubran and her family were featured in Telling Strings (2007), a documentary about generational differences and cultural identity in [Palestine].

She moved to Jerusalem in 1981 to study social work at the Hebrew University. It was there that Jubran discovered her identity, history and heritage. After being introduced to Said Murad, the founder of musical group Sabreen (patient ones), Jubran joined the group in 1982 (2 years after its foundation) and became the only Palestinian member who had been born in Israel. In 2002, she moved to Europe.
